A heartbreaking inquest into the death of a 12-year-old boy found hanged at home has heard that he may not have intended to take his own life. Riley Townsend from Nottingham was discovered in his bedroom on September 1, 2024.
His devasted mum Abi Louise Hill said she had long struggled to get her son an autism diagnosis and said he had told friends at school that tightening his school tie around his neck made him feel "floaty."
